#1ba30b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1ba30b is composed of 10.6% red, 63.9% green and 4.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 93.3% yellow and 36.1% black. It has a hue angle of 113.7 degrees, a saturation of 87.4% and a lightness of 34.1%. #1ba30b color hex could be obtained by blending #36ff16 with #004700.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

Shades and Tints of #1ba30b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#031001 is the darkest color, while #fdfff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#1ba30b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#555955 is the less saturated color, while #16aa04 is the most saturated one.
